final instructions Aug 17-21 band rehearsals
Final instructions before varsity band conditioning/rehearsals:
Monday, Aug. 17- new varsity marchers and section leaders
Tues-Fri, Aug. 18-21- all varsity marchers
Sat & Monday, Aug. 22 & 24- all varsity percussion
All students are required to bring: tennis shoes with socks (no flip flops) mask, water bottle, instrument. All students are encouraged to bring flip folder/lyre (if a returning student), hat, sun screen, sun glasses.
All students should report to the stadium entrance to check in. Upon arrival, you’ll be asked the following questions, via QR code with your cell phone (we’ll have an I-pad if you don’t have a phone):
1. In the past 24 hours, have you had any of the following symptoms?
Fever (temperature of 100 or above)*
Chills Cough
Shortness of breath Fatigue
New loss of taste/smell Runny nose, congestion
Sore throat Muscle or body aches
Headache Nausea, vomiting, diarrhea
*If you do not have access to a thermometer, please contact the school nurse for assistance.
2. If the answer is YES to any of the above listed symptoms, STAY HOME and monitor for 24 hours. If the symptoms persist, contact your healthcare provider.
3. In the past 14 days, have you been within 6 feet of someone for 10 minutes or greater who was diagnosed with COVID-19? If the answer is YES, stay home and contact your school nurse for additional instructions.
4. In the past 14 days, have you had contact with the mucous/saliva of someone who has been diagnosed with COVID-19? If the answer is YES, stay home and contact your school nurse for additional instructions.
5. Are you asymptomatic, but waiting on results from a COVID test? If so, stay home until you have your test results. Notify your school nurse of your results before returning to school.
6. Have you traveled to a location requiring quarantine? If the answer is YES, quarantine (stay home) for 14 days and monitor for symptoms. If symptoms develop, stay home and contact your primary healthcare provider.
Once you check in, you will be directed to the upper football field, which is behind the stadium. If you have your personal instrument (or need to check a school instrument out) or flip folder that is currently in the band room, you will be directed to the band room to retrieve those items. Students will be allowed in the band room, one at a time, to retrieve these items.
Although rehearsal begins at 8:00AM, we will be ready to begin the check in process at 7:30.<webextlink://Although%20rehearsal%20begins%20at%208:00AM,%20we%20will%20be%20ready%20to%20begin%20the%20check%20in%20process%20at%207:30.> Please, if you are able, arrive on the early side (closer to 7:30). This will facilitate the check in process so we can begin playing as soon as possible. We will begin on the upper field for music rehearsal. We will then transfer to the main stadium field around 9:15AM for conditioning and marching rehearsal. We will wrap up every day at 11:00AM.
A couple other rules, as set by the district:
-Parents and alum are not allowed to stay and watch, even to help
– students should remain 6 feet apart at all times.
-masks are to be worn before and after rehearsal. Masks can be taken off while playing or during intense physical activity.
– students should not car pool
– students cannot share water, so it’s important to remember your own water bottle.
